What Are Freestyle Type Beats?

To understand the relevance of freestyle trap beats, it's necessary to first break down what a freestyle beat in fact is. In basic terms, a freestyle beat is an instrumental track that is made for musicians to rap or sing over without the need for pre-written lyrics or tunes. It's implied to motivate off-the-cuff efficiencies, motivating rappers to deliver spontaneous and usually extra raw, impulsive verses.

A freestyle type beat differs somewhat from a normal instrumental in that it's structured in such a way that gives musicians room to breathe. These beats usually have fewer ariose aspects, leaving area for intricate flows and powerful wordplay. They're likewise generally extra repeated than typical song instrumentals, making sure that the rap artist or vocalist can easily find their groove and ride the beat without getting lost in complex plans.

Freestyle Trap Beats A Subgenre Within Freestyle

Currently, within the dimension of freestyle beats, there is a particular subset referred to as freestyle trap beat. Trap songs, originating from the southern United States, is defined by intense use of 808 bass drums, quick hi-hat patterns, and dark, irritable melodies. It's a sound that has actually expanded in appeal throughout the years, turning into one of one of the most significant styles in modern rap.

Freestyle trap beats take these trademark factors and fuse them with the flexibility and flexibility of freestyle beats, resulting in a efficient mix. These beats are perfect for musicians aiming to bring power and hostility to their verses while still preserving the freedom to discover various flows and designs.

What Is a Free Type Beat?

A free type beat is an instrumental that producers use free of cost usage, typically for non-commercial purposes. While the beats can be used for demonstrations, freestyles, and social networks content, musicians usually require to invest in a permit if they wish to release the song readily (i.e., on streaming systems or for sale).

This version has actually been a game-changer, enabling young artists to try out their sound, exercise their freestyling, and construct an internet-based visibility without needing to fret about production prices.
